The Race to Agentic AI: Expectations, Readiness, and Real-World Results

The Era of Autonomous Execution
Agentic AI is ushering in a new phase of digital transformation. We are moving beyond mere content generation to systems that can autonomously execute complex, multi-step tasks. According to a recent report, 84% of leaders believe Agentic AI will fundamentally change their business, and 90% predict their entire industry will adopt this technology in the near future.
1. High Expectations vs. Limited Effectiveness
While 74% of executives consider AI critical to their mission, only 26% feel their organization is currently using AI effectively. The gap between ambition and execution remains the single biggest hurdle for enterprise adoption.
2. The Main Barriers
Why are organizations struggling to maintain pace? Two challenges stand out:
- •The Skills Gap (48%): Finding talent capable of building and orchestrating autonomous systems is a significant bottleneck.
- •Lack of Strategic Clarity (46%): Many firms launch initiatives without a clear roadmap for long-term integration.
Technological infrastructure, governance models, and legacy system integration further complicate the rollout.
3. Disparity in Organizational Readiness
Most organizations categorize themselves as only "moderately prepared" across key pillars like data quality, governance, and human capital. Perhaps most tellingly, very few enterprises have established clear success metrics (KPIs) for Agentic AI, making ROI difficult to prove.
